|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or Chip Repair | $150 - $400 |
| Crack Repair | $300 - $900 |
| Surface Resurfacing | $1,200 - $3,000 |
| Full Tile Replacement | $2,500 - $6,500 |
| Sealing and Polishing | $250 - $700 |
Key Cost Influencers
Granite tile repair in Rome, GA, involves restoring the appearance and functionality of damaged or worn granite surfaces. Whether addressing cracks, chips, or surface wear, underst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ning the project.
- Materials used: Repair often involves matching existing granite, epoxy fillers, or grout to blend seamlessly with the surrounding surface.
- Size and scope: Repairs can range from small chips to extensive cracks across a few tiles or larger areas requiring replacement.
- Labor complexity: Surface repairs are generally straightforward, but extensive damage or structural issues may require more intricate work.
- Permitting considerations: Most granite tile repairs do not require permits, but larger renovations might need local approval depending on scope.
- Additional services: Options may include sealing, polishing, or surface refinishing to restore the tile’s appearance after repairs.
Project Size Considerations
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small Chips or Cracks (less than 2 inches) | $150 - $300 |
| Moderate Damage (2 to 6 inches) | $300 - $700 |
| Large Cracks or Multiple Chips | $700 - $1,500 |
| Full Tile Replacement | $1,500 - $3,000 |
